Bodega de Forlong ‘La Fleur’ Palomino Fino 2017 Size::6 Bottle Case Call it what you willOrganic, hand picked Palomino from 'Finca Forlong' in Pago Balbaina Baja, in Puerto de Santa Maria, grown in Tosca Cerrada Albariza with some alluvial lustrillo. After picking, the fruit is given 2 days of asoleo, is pressed, spends 6 months with lees in bota then 24 months under velo de florCumquat, lemon rind, pistachio flesh, almond skin, salted hay syprup and parmesan tang. Iodine screams of the ocean's nearness. The fruit is vertical and electric
